  18. I know Both state and federal officials do that kind of thing in Alaska. They're very creative in closing access. In the case of Six Rivers National Forest (the Bluff Creek Area) it's closed each winter to protect Port-Orford-cedar (POC) trees from the spread of POC root disease. These closures, primarily in the Gasquet and Orleans/Lower Trinity Ranger Districts, are triggered by wet weather and typically last through the rainy season. In effect, protecting Port Orford cedar trees has the side benefit of protecting sasquatches. See how that works?

  25. Supposedly neither. He was brought in because he showed aptitude in building jet propulsion cars on his own dime and time for fun. This sounds just like Uncle Sam: when the pinheads can't get it done, bring in somebody who might. Element 115. Moscovium. It was first synthesized in 2003 by a joint Russian-American team at the Joint Institute for Nuclear Research (JINR) in Dubna, Russia. Due to its radioactive nature and instability, it does not occur naturally and is only used for scientific study. I don't know when Lazar first cited E115, but it was well before 2003. E115 has still not been stabilized. Again, I still don't know what to make of Bob Lazar.
